Social Media and Digital Marketing Strategy

Introduction of Social Media and Digital Marketing Strategy

Social media and digital marketing strategy research is a dynamic and critical field that delves into the development, implementation, and optimization of strategies to effectively leverage digital platforms and social media for marketing and brand promotion. In today's digitally connected world, understanding these strategies is essential for businesses and marketers aiming to engage their target audiences, foster brand loyalty, and drive measurable results in the online marketplace.

Social Media and Digital Marketing Strategy:

Content Marketing Strategy:

Investigating the development and execution of content marketing plans, including content creation, distribution, and measurement, to attract and retain a relevant audience.

Social Media Advertising Strategy:

Analyzing strategies for paid advertising on social media platforms, including targeting, ad format selection, budget allocation, and performance tracking.

Influencer Marketing Strategy:

Researching influencer identification, partnership strategies, and measurement techniques to harness the reach and credibility of influencers for brand promotion.

Omnichannel Marketing Strategy:

Studying the creation of cohesive marketing strategies that seamlessly integrate multiple channels, including social media, email marketing, SEO, and paid advertising, to provide consistent brand experiences.

Data-Driven Marketing Strategy:

Exploring the use of data analytics, customer insights, and performance metrics to inform marketing decisions, refine strategies, and achieve measurable ROI.

Customer Journey Mapping:

Investigating the process of mapping and optimizing the customer journey across digital channels, including identifying touchpoints, pain points, and opportunities for engagement.

Mobile-First Marketing Strategy:

Analyzing strategies tailored to mobile users, considering mobile optimization, app marketing, and location-based targeting in the overall marketing mix.

E-commerce Marketing Strategy:

Researching strategies specific to online retailers, including product listings, shopping cart optimization, conversion rate optimization (CRO), and remarketing tactics.

Social Responsibility and Ethical Marketing:

Studying how socially responsible and ethical marketing strategies can build brand reputation and resonate with conscious consumers in a digital age.

Crisis Management and Reputation Strategy:

Exploring strategies for crisis communication, reputation management, and brand resilience in the face of online challenges, such as negative social media trends or public relations crises.

Video Marketing

Introduction of Video Marketing

Video marketing research is a dynamic field that explores the strategies, tools, and techniques used to create, distribute, and optimize video content for marketing purposes. In today's digital landscape, video has emerged as a powerful medium for engaging and connecting with audiences. Understanding video marketing is crucial for businesses and marketers looking to leverage the visual and interactive appeal of video to drive brand awareness, engagement, and conversions.

Video Marketing:

Video Content Creation and Production:

Investigating the processes and best practices for creating high-quality video content, including scripting, filming, editing, and post-production techniques.

Video SEO and Optimization:

Analyzing strategies to optimize video content for search engines, including video metadata, transcripts, and thumbnail optimization, to improve discoverability.

Video Distribution and Promotion:

Researching the various platforms and channels for distributing video content, from social media and video-sharing platforms to email marketing and website integration.

Live Streaming and Real-Time Engagement:

Studying the use of live streaming for real-time engagement with audiences, including live webinars, product launches, and Q&A sessions.

Video Analytics and Performance Measurement:

Exploring the use of video analytics tools to track viewer engagement, view duration, click-through rates, and other key performance metrics for video marketing campaigns.

Personalization and Interactive Video:

Investigating strategies for creating personalized video content and interactive experiences, such as interactive video ads and shoppable videos.

Storytelling and Narrative in Video Marketing:

Analyzing the role of storytelling techniques and narrative structures in creating compelling video content that resonates with audiences.

Video Marketing on Social Media:

Researching the unique strategies and formats for video marketing on popular social media platforms like Facebook, Instagram, YouTube, and TikTok.

User-Generated Video Content:

Studying the use of user-generated content and customer testimonials in video marketing campaigns, including best practices for collecting and incorporating user-generated videos.

Emerging Trends in Video Marketing:

Exploring the latest trends and technologies in video marketing, such as 360-degree videos, vir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and the integration of AI in video content creation and recommendations.
